Baddest Blue Rules

 
 

Dream Jiu Jitsu follows the standards of bigger organizations with a few exceptions and changes of our own. While we want our competitors to play by the same rules as everyone else, ultimately competition should be designed for you to become a better grappler. We believe our rules and format reflect that idea. All questions should be sent by email.

 All Baddest Blue tournaments are submission only with no time limit.

Baddest Blue Format

Submission Only

Baddest Blue tournaments are submission only and will not have points or advantages.

Time Limit

No Time Limit​

Legal Submissions

All divisions will follow the IBJJF Legal Technique system with the below exceptions:​

Kneebars are legal.
Twisters are legal.

These additional submissions are added in order to have more options to end a match.
There are no points or advantages. A match can only end in submission or disqualification.

Disqualification

A competitor will be disqualified if they break established grappling norms, attempt an illegal technique*, strike or slam their opponent, crank their opponent’s neck (can opener, etc), bending fingers, etc.

*The referee will determine whether an attempt of an illegal technique is accidental or intentional. If you are reaping the knee of your opponent, the referee will pause the match and reset the legs into a legal position to continue the match.

If you transition from a straight ankle lock to a heel hook, the referee will disqualify you.​
